
Strong families build strong communities — and partnership makes it possible.
Rosalee Cares collaborates with hospitals, public health agencies, nonprofits, schools, workforce programs, funders, corporations, and community organizations to improve outcomes for postpartum mothers, teen families, and aging adults across Georgia.
Together, we expand access to care, reduce preventable complications, and support caregivers when they need it most.
Organizations choose Rosalee Cares because we provide:
• Postpartum navigation and recovery support
• Teen and underserved mom programs
• Elder respite care for overwhelmed caregivers
• Community workforce training for doulas and caregivers
• Equity-centered care models and culturally aligned support
• Proven program frameworks ready to scale through partners
We bring lived experience + clinical training + community trust.
